EDUCATION

  • Graduate or professional work or advanced degree; or equivalent experience Advanced Professional Education to support required licensing required.
  • A minimum of a master’s degree (Nursing or Physician Assistant Studies) is required.

LICENSES AND CERTIFICATIONS

  • Current license in the state of Texas (RN and APRN for Nurse Practitioner, PA for Physician Assistant), required.
  • Appropriate accompanying board certification to state license, required.
  • Current CPR/BLS for the Healthcare Provider from the American Heart Association, upon hire required.
  • APN: Current licensure as a Registered Nurse in the State of Texas (or current valid Compact RN license) upon hire required.
  • APN: Current certification as a Nurse Practitioner by a national certifying body recognized by the Texas Board of Nursing in the appropriate population focus area upon hire required.
  • PA: Current certificate issued by the National Commission on Certification of Physician Assistants upon hire required.
  • APN & PA: BLS Certification from the American Heart Association required upon hire
  • APN & PA: Current NRP (Neonatal Resuscitation Program) certification if practicing in the neonatal intensive care unit (NICU) upon hire required.
  • APN & PA with hospital privileges: Current PALS (Pediatric Advanced Life Support) certification 180 days required.
